In the Peru Advanced Energy Storage Systems Market, there are several challenges that industry players face. One of the primary obstacles is the lack of a comprehensive regulatory framework that governs the deployment and integration of advanced energy storage technologies. This regulatory uncertainty hampers investment and implementation efforts, as market participants are unsure of the incentives, tariffs, and standards that may apply to their projects. Additionally, the high upfront costs associated with advanced energy storage systems pose a financial barrier for many potential adopters, especially in a market where traditional energy sources still dominate. Limited public awareness and understanding of the benefits of energy storage further complicate market development efforts. Overcoming these challenges will require coordinated efforts from policymakers, industry stakeholders, and investors to create a conducive environment for the growth of advanced energy storage in Peru.

In Peru, government policies related to the Advanced Energy Storage Systems Market focus on promoting renewable energy sources and increasing energy efficiency. The government has implemented measures such as the National Energy Policy 2010-2040 and the Energy Efficiency Law to encourage the adoption of advanced energy storage technologies. Additionally, Peru aims to reduce its reliance on fossil fuels and mitigate climate change impacts through initiatives like the National Plan for Sustainable Energy Development and the Renewable Energy Incentive Program. These policies provide incentives and support for the development and deployment of advanced energy storage systems to enhance grid stability, increase energy security, and promote sustainable energy practices in the country.
